Director of Partner Operations Summary: 

The Director of Partner Operations plays a pivotal role in supporting the execution of Delinea’s partner strategy. This position is responsible for overseeing the global operational framework that supports our partnerships and ensuring alignment with our business objectives. This position is instrumental in translating the strategic vision into actionable plans, driving implementation, and ensuring successful execution across all operational facets. The Director of Partner Operations focuses on the development, implementation, and ownership of processes that enhance partner engagement and operational efficiency. 

You will be joining Delinea as a key member of the Sales Operations organization and will work closely with Delinea’s partner, sales, legal, customer success and marketing teams to drive operational excellence within the partner program and maximum value to our customers. You will report to the VP of Global Sales Operations. 

 

What You’ll Do: 

  • Partner Strategy Execution – Develop and implement operational strategies that align with Delinea’s partner objectives, enhancing partner performance and engagement. 

  • Process Optimization – Identify and implement best practices and process improvements to streamline partner onboarding, training and ongoing support. 

  • Partner Portal Management - Own the partner’s sales process from a system perspective from end to end. This includes ensuring that the Partner Relationship Management (PRM) ‘s current functions are optimized and scalable and building additional functionalities as the business evolves. 

  • Partner Program Tools and Processes - Ensure there is consistency across all partner-facing tools and processes including partner onboarding/training program, partner program guides, internal process documentation, and partner incentive management. 

  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Work closely with Sales, Marketing, Systems, and Customer Success teams to align partner initiatives with company objectives and ensure cohesive execution of partner programs. 

  • Performance Metrics: Define and track key performance indicators (KPIs) to measure the success of partner operations. Provide regular reports and insights to the VP of Global GTM Operations and other stakeholders. 

  • Change Management: Lead initiatives to drive continuous improvement within partner operations, leveraging feedback from partners and internal stakeholders to enhance workflows and processes. 

 

What You’ll Bring: 

  • 7+ years of experience in partner operations, channel management, or a related role within the technology sector; 3+ years of experience in supporting a global program 

  • Proven track record of managing complex partner relationships and driving operational excellence. 

  •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ret data and make informed decisions. 

  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to influence and collaborate with stakeholders at all levels. 

  • Experience in project management and process improvement methodologies. 

  • Knowledge of the cybersecurity industry and familiarity with Delinea’s products is a plus.
